We have rotated the key used to sign log-compaction snapshots produced by the Wrenpost message queue. Support team: customers on Wrenpost 3.7 or earlier will see verification warnings when restoring snapshots created after this release; advise them to upgrade their verifier bundle first. Snapshots signed under the previous key remain restorable through the end of the Larkfield support window. When walking customers through manual verification, confirm they are checking against the new key, listed below.

deploy key for yajop-fahop: bky3_h1v

## Localizing Date Formats

Quick note before your first review on Calendrix: we never hand-roll date strings. Everything routes through the Polyglot formatting service, which owns locale rules — so if you see `strftime` in a diff, flag it. To test locale output locally, the formatter CLI needs to authenticate against the staging Polyglot endpoint. Tokens are short-lived, so don't commit them anywhere. The current staging key is below.

service key, yadug-bajog: zpat3_pou

Ticket: Staging env misconfigured for Siftgate bloom filter

The bloom layer in front of the Pellet KV store is rejecting all lookups in staging because the env file was copied from the dev template without credentials. False-positive tuning values are fine; only the auth line is missing. To unblock the weekly demo, the Pellet admission secret must be set on the following line.

env line for yaguf-fajop: LEDGER_TOKEN13=fb08984397349

## AddrSnap Environments

Quick refresher before the sync: AddrSnap (the address autocomplete widget) runs in three environments — dev, staging, and prod. Dev points at the synthetic Mapletown gazetteer, so don't panic when it suggests streets that don't exist. Staging mirrors prod data with a 24h lag; it's the right place to test ranking tweaks. Prod is fronted by the Quillgate edge cache, so changes can take ~10 minutes to show. To hit staging from your local build, use the environment settings listed below.

config for kajog-tadug:
[casax]
port = 11211
region = west-3
host = casax.nelvroworks.internal
timeout_ms = 5000
retries = 7